Explanation:
Gloria feels she is not treated fair in terms of pay she receives. She believes that there is injustice and unfairness in provision of salary. This is referred to as distributive injustice. Gloria is believes that she is facing distributive injustice so she is angry and is wasting time during office work. She is not motivated towards her work. She is demotivated and feels lazy because she feels there is unfairness in distribution of salary payment.

An indifference curve can be defined as the graphical representation of two products (commodities) that gives a customer equal utility and satisfaction and as such making him or her indifferent about them as they are equally happy.
Hence, an indifference curve shows the various bundles of goods that make the consumer equally happy.
